I should know this by now. :eek: What is the best (not cheapest)way to increase alkalinity? thanks
 
Like Jim said...baking or washing soda. But be careful, if you add too much at once your ph will go through the roof. You need to add it slowly. I add it by a drip on a timer.
 
What effect does the baking soda have on the ph?

I know I use washing soda every once in a while, but I have to add it VERY slowly because it also causes the ph to go up.
 
Baking soda causes your PH to drop unless you bake it in the oven @ 300 deg for an hour then it will raise your PH
Washing sode I beleive will raise you PH but I do not think it is as pure as baking sode

Well, it causes your pH to go to around 8.0
If your pH is higher than that, it will drop to 8.
If your pH is lower, it'll raise the pH to 8.

Washing Soda will usually raise the pH a few points.
